Volatile specifics (length norms, abstract cap, named editors) change over time. Treat them as durable norms and verify the current Manuscript Submission Guidelines at journals.sagepub.com/author-instructions/asq and the live portal at https://mc.manuscriptcentral.com/asq before submitting.
Fees. ASQ is a hybrid journal with no submission fee and no mandatory publication fee. Optional gold open access costs an article processing charge (APC) of US$3,000, billed only after acceptance if you opt in. Do not budget a submission fee — there is none.
Reference style: APA. As of January 2025, ASQ uses APA style for in-text citations and the reference list (this changed from its older in-house ASQ style — verify you are on the current APA convention).
Fit pre-check (do not skip)
- The manuscript delivers a surprising theoretical insight about organizations (not just a finding)
- The contribution is theoretical, not methodological
- The phenomenon is in ASQ's wheelhouse (organization theory / sociology of organizations)
- You can name the conversation it joins and a few recent ASQ articles as anchors
- If it is a pure conceptual paper with no data, reconsider (AMR may fit better)
Format
- Manuscript type selected correctly (research article vs. book review — ASQ runs a standing book review section, unusual among top management journals)
- One key point statable in a single sentence (ASQ: "each manuscript should contain one key point")
- Title page (with author info) is a separate file from the main document
- Abstract is 200 words or fewer, jargon-free; keywords drawn from the ASQ ScholarOne keyword list
- Length near the suggested 35–45 pages of text (12-pt Times New Roman, double-spaced, 1-inch margins) plus refs/tables/figures; over-long files get unsubmitted before review
- References in APA style (ASQ adopted APA in January 2025)
- Manuscript in Word or PDF (Word required later if accepted); supplemental material placed online and anonymized
- Data & Methods Transparency plan ready (a required ScholarOne item at submission)
Anonymization (double-blind)
- Main document contains no author-identifying information
- Self-citations phrased neutrally ("prior work (Author, 2020) shows…"), not "in our earlier study"
- Acknowledgments, funding, and thanks removed from the main file (placed on the separate title page)
- Field site / data provider not identifiable if that would reveal the authors
- File properties/metadata scrubbed of author names and affiliations
- File names contain no author names
Exhibits & evidence
- Qualitative: data-structure figure and data-to-theory/evidence table included
- Quantitative: descriptives, correlations, and main tables complete and self-contained
- Every exhibit numbered, titled, noted, and referenced in text
- Online supplement / appendix prepared if used (interview guide, extra quotes, robustness)
References & citations
- Every in-text citation appears in the reference list and vice versa
- Recent and canonical organization-theory works both engaged
- DOIs/page numbers complete; no "in press" left unresolved if now published
Editorial system & metadata
- Account created at ASQ's ScholarOne portal (https://mc.manuscriptcentral.com/asq) — no submission fee
- Cover letter does not summarize the paper; it lists prior viewers/conflicts and discloses any data overlap with other work (ASQ's overlap rule is broad)
- Keywords from the ASQ ScholarOne keyword list; suggested reviewers named in the cover letter (the form no longer accepts them)
- Declarations done (originality, COPE ethics, data transparency)
- Not under review elsewhere and not previously rejected by ASQ (no resubmissions of rejected papers)
Anti-patterns
- Submitting a thin-theory, sophisticated-method paper to a theory-first journal
- Forgetting to anonymize self-citations, acknowledgments, or file metadata (ASQ review is double-blind)
- A cover letter that summarizes the paper (ASQ says this is not useful) instead of disclosing overlap and conflicts
- Exhibits not self-contained; figures illegible in grayscale
- A bloated manuscript well past ~45 pages — length-to-contribution is an explicit evaluation criterion, and editors will unsubmit it
- Using old in-house ASQ references instead of APA (changed January 2025)
- Resubmitting a paper ASQ already rejected (not permitted)
